The survey did not ask respondents <br />why they do not use the park because the purpose of the study was to focus on housing <br />issues. <br />Table 1.25 <br />The Most Important Improvem ents That Should be Made <br />Most Important Improvement That Should <br />Be Made Areal Area II Area III Area IV Total <br />Revamping of Dilapidated Houses <br />Traffic (noise, speeds, volume, etc.) <br />Improve Streets <br />Improve Street Lighting <br />Yard Cleanup <br />Animal Control (loose, barking, etc.) <br />Improve Power Lines <br />Install Sidewalks/Trails <br />Restricting On Street Parking <br />Control Lord Fletcher’s Externalities <br />Better Snow Removal <br />Overhaul Navane Park <br />Safe Crosswalk <br />City Purchase Railroad/Convert to Street <br />Lower Taxes <br />No More Biker/Jogging Events <br />Stop Sewer Flow Into Lake Minnetonka <br />Close Crystal Bay Road to Through Traffic <br />Allow Expansion of Houses On Lake <br />Bring Income Levels Together <br />Stop Dumping in/by Wetlands and Railroad <br />6 7 2 8 23 <br />10 2 n/a 6 18 <br />2 9 n/a 5 16 <br />2 1 1 9 13 <br />n/a 3 3 7 13 <br />1 1 n/a 2 4 <br />1 2 n/a n/a 3 <br />n/a 1 n/a 1 2 <br />1 n/a n/a 1 2 <br />2 n/a n/a n/a 2 <br />1 1 n/a n/a 2 <br />n/a n/a n/a 2 2 <br />1 n/a n/a n/a 1 <br />1 n/a n/a n/a 1 <br />1 n/a n/a n/a 1 <br />1 n/a n/a n/a 1 <br />1 n/a n/a n/a 1 <br />n/a 1 n/a n/a 1 <br />n/a 1 n/a n/a 1 <br />n/a n/a n/a 1 1 <br />I n/a n/a n/a 1 <br />Residents were asked to list their single most important concern regarding the <br />neighborhood. Improving the condition of the houses in the neighborhood was the single <br />most important improvement that should be made according to survey respondents. This <br />concern was equally great in all study areas, except Area III, which has relatively new <br />duplexes. Other various improvements which at least ten or more respondents listed <br />include traffic control, improving street conditions, lighting and the cleanup of unkempt <br />yards. Traffic control was the greatest concern in areas I and IV. The improvement of <br />streets was chiefly a concern in areas II and IV, which are the core areas of Navarre in <br />this study.
